I have tried to play Stellaris in 3840x2160 resolution on my 4k display, but all the text and UI graphics are super-tiny, so I had to switch to 1080p which is a shame.

Is there a way to make UI larger on 4k?
 
I changed it to 1.7 and it made it much better. Just have to get used to making sure that I have the item that I am right-clicking on in the left portion of the screen, so that I can actually see the context menu that pops up. It is workable - thanks.
 
I'm using a 4K, too. UI works fine with 1440p, that's 4:3 (+33%) compared to 1080p. I've tried 2160p which is another 3:2 (+50%) but the UI becomes too tiny to be satisfying. Instead of playing Stallaris, EU IV, ... in 4K with 1.5 scaling I switch to 2560x1440 without scaling.
